Cachet's Story

She seems to be 'saying' she's ready to give it a try.?--She is a very sweet dog, and although she is painfully shy, she shows that she wants to trust people, play, and have fun. It's just as if she has to break down her barrier to let it happen. It is hard for her to relax with the shelter energy around her. In spite of her anxiety, she has never shown any aggression. She is agreeable to go for walks, and does great on them. She is somewhat more at ease in the Home Room/office. She will require love and patience. While there are no guarantees-only hope, we have seen remarkable turn-a-rounds with similar pets when they find their families... -Please PHONE or COME BY the shelter if you would like more information on Cachet.

Ozark-Dale County Humane Society's Adoption Policy
After choosing the pet you are interested in, we require an adoption application to ensure your environment is a good fit for the pet you have chosen. When you have met and made the final decision to adopt the pet, we require an adoption contract to make certain you will be a good caregiver. Adoption fees are $125.00 for dogs/puppies and $75.00 adoption fee for cats/kittens. All age eligible pets are spayed or neutered prior to completion of the adoption process. If the pet is too young for surgery, you will be provided a date for surgery per the adoption contract. (Included in adoption fee.) If you choose to use your own vet, we will reimburse surgery fees up to the amount our vet is charging. Dogs are heart worm tested, on preventative, spay/neutered (if of age), and have vaccinations up to date, and micro-chipped. Cats are Feline Leukemia/Aids tested, spay/neutered (if of age), vaccinations up to date, and micro-chipped upon request. ~We also require a vet reference and/or home visit or alternate information.
